About vgmt monthly

vgmt monthly is a monthly newsletter that offers a centralized place for the VGM community to make announcements about songs, events, conventions and more! The newsletter will be posted on vgmtogether's social media and archived on this website. You are free to print or share the newsletter!

    May 22
    • Lowlander
    • Battle Network
    • Get ready to jack in to Mega Man Battle Network! Revisit the world of the Net alongside Lan and MegaMan.EXE with this EP, which spans all six main themes from the Battle Network games. Brought to you by Battle Network megafan Lowlander, this EP takes you back to the heyday of the Blue Bomber on the Game Boy Advance through hard-hitting drums, powerful synths, and screaming guitar leads.

    May 17
    • Virtual Video Game Soundtrack
    • Wake Up, Get Up, Get Out There (Persona 5)
    • Virtual Video Game Orchestra is proud to present our twenty-fourth project, “Wake Up, Get Up, Get Out There” from Persona 5, along with end credits arrangement “Life Goes On” from Persona 5. These two performances feature 187 submissions on 49 unique instruments from 57 individual players across the global video game music community.

    May 01
    • Madison Drace
    • The GLaDOS Monologues: Ariosos for voice, piano, and violin
    • Madison Drace, accompanied by Matthew Thompson on piano and Dana Plank on violin, premiered “The GLaDOS Monologues: Ariosos for Voice, Piano and Violin” at the North American Conference on Video Game Music. This theatrical performance is an original work composed by Gregg Rossetti and based on text from Portal 2.

    Jul 20
    • 2026 Video Game Strings Music Camp
    • Calling middle and high school orchestra strings players! Live close to Loudoun County, VA? We are hosting a week-long orchestra Strings Camp! Camp will be July 20-24 from 10am to 3pm at Watson Mountain Middle School in Ashburn, VA and is open to all strings players with at least one year of experience. Five days of rehearsals will end in a video game music concert for family and friends! Please check out Loudoun.Bit Music Collective to find out more and see you at camp!

    Jul 30
    • Beeps 'n Bops Winnipeg 2026
    • Beeps ‘n Bops returns to Winnipeg with more awesome video game music for you to enjoy. This time with 100% Winnipeg artists! Featuring the rock of SuperFX, the jazz fusion of 8-Bit & the Single Players, the classical styles of the Winnipeg Video Game Orchestra and the melodic tunes of Shea’s Violin! Also featuring video game music trivia, a cosplay contest, and a silent auction with prizes donated by local sponsors! All ages welcome!
